The Indian government has announced the recruitment of up to 20 consultants for the 8th Pay Commission, inviting applications from qualified individuals. Interested candidates can apply through the official website of the 8th CPC. The consultants will be responsible for analyzing salaries, pay structures, and allowances, as well as conducting legal research and coordinating with various government ministries. There are three categories of consultants: Senior Consultant (10+ years of experience, age limit 45), Consultant (6+ years, age limit 40), and Young Professional (4+ years, age limit 32). The fixed monthly salary varies by category, but candidates should note that there will be no additional remuneration increases or benefits such as accommodation or medical reimbursements. The engagement is temporary and can be terminated at any time without reason.
